The Dangers of Mosquito Infestations

While mosquitoes are frequently viewed as merely irritating, they are actually classified as one of the most dangerous animals on the planet due to their ability to transmit disease. In our region, the threat extends beyond simple discomfort. These pests are vectors for a variety of illnesses that can affect humans, including West Nile Virus, Eastern Equine Encephalitis, and Zika Virus. The risk is particularly high during dawn and dusk when many species are most active, and families are likely to be outside.

Furthermore, the impact on pets can be severe. Mosquitoes are the primary transmitter of heartworm larvae to dogs and cats, a condition that can be fatal if left untreated. Because of these risks, controlling the mosquito population is a matter of health and safety for the entire household.

  • Disease Transmission: Mosquitoes can carry dangerous pathogens that affect the nervous system and overall health of humans.
  • Allergic Reactions: Many individuals, especially children, suffer from significant swelling and allergic reactions to mosquito saliva.
  • Pet Safety: The bite of a single infected mosquito can transmit heartworm disease to dogs and cats, leading to costly veterinary bills and health struggles.

Effective control measures are necessary to minimize these risks and create a safer environment for everyone in the home.

Why Professional Mosquito Control is Essential

Many homeowners attempt to control mosquitoes with DIY solutions like citronella candles, bug zappers, or store-bought sprays, but these methods rarely offer lasting results. Most retail products act as localized repellents rather than population control, pushing mosquitoes just a few feet away without reducing their numbers. They fail to address the root of the problem: the breeding sites and the larvae developing in stagnant water around the property.

Professional mosquito control involves a scientific understanding of insect biology and behavior. Experts know specifically where to look for potential breeding grounds—areas that the average homeowner might overlook, such as clogged gutters, birdbaths, or potted plant saucers. By targeting these source points with specialized larvicides that are unavailable to the general public, professionals can stop the next generation of mosquitoes before they ever take flight.

Additionally, professional treatments utilize residual products applied to foliage where mosquitoes rest. This creates a barrier that continues to work for weeks after the application, providing consistent protection rather than the momentary relief offered by sprays. This comprehensive strategy drastically reduces the overall mosquito population on the property, creating a genuine zone of protection that allows families to reclaim their outdoor living spaces safely.

Reducing Breeding Sites in Your Yard

To maximize the effectiveness of professional treatment, homeowners can take simple steps to eliminate breeding grounds. Mosquitoes need standing water to lay their eggs, and they can breed in amounts as small as a bottle cap. Regularly inspect your yard for containers that collect rainwater, such as flower pots, buckets, old tires, and children's toys, and empty them. It is also important to ensure that birdbaths are cleaned and refilled weekly to disrupt the breeding cycle.

Maintenance of your home's exterior also plays a role. Clogged gutters are a common hidden source of standing water; keeping them clean ensures proper drainage. Keeping your lawn mowed and trimming back dense vegetation reduces the cool, shady areas where adult mosquitoes like to rest during the heat of the day. By combining these property maintenance habits with our professional services, you can significantly lower the mosquito population around your home.
